Defining “Naive”

The phrase “naive” typically evokes a way of innocence and an absence of worldly expertise. Nevertheless, its that means might be multifaceted and context-dependent, extending past easy goodness. Understanding its nuances throughout numerous contexts is essential for efficient communication and correct interpretation.
Concise Definition
“Naive” describes an absence of expertise, judgment, or consciousness, typically resulting in a very optimistic or simplistic view of the world. This may manifest in social interactions, emotional responses, or mental pursuits. It is often related to an absence of cynicism or a bent to belief others readily.

Synonyms and Antonyms
A variety of synonyms captures the totally different aspects of “naive.” Phrases like “harmless,” “inexperienced,” “unsophisticated,” and “credulous” all spotlight totally different facets of naiveté. Antonyms, conversely, emphasize the presence of expertise, judgment, and worldly knowledge, corresponding to “subtle,” “worldly,” “astute,” and “cynical.”
